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Heworth to Woodhouse start from as little as £12.40

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Heworth to Woodhouse start from £84.30 one way, or £85.40 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Heworth to Woodhouse are available for £86.20 one way, or £131.20 return

Station Facilities and Accessibility

Despite its unassuming nature, Heworth Station provides some basic amenities. There is no manned ticket office, but passengers can easily buy and collect pre-purchased tickets using the available ticket machines, which are fully accessible. The station is categorized as a Category B Station, meaning that while it is unstaffed, it has ramped access to platforms, ensuring wheelchair users and those with mobility impairments can navigate without issues. However, do note that facilities like toilets, waiting rooms, refreshment services, and bicycle storage are lacking, perhaps making it more of a transit point than a hangout location.

Though CCTV is not present, there are customer help points scattered throughout the station to ensure assistance is just a call away, offering a sense of security and support to travelers. For those seeking additional help, the conductor on the arriving train is available to assist with boarding and disembarking needs. Facilities and Accessibility

Woodhouse station may not boast extensive high-end amenities, but it certainly covers the basics. You'll find ticket machines available for purchasing or collecting tickets bought online, which is handy since there isn't a staffed ticket office. However, it's worth noting that these machines are not accessible for all due to a lack of accessibility features. Induction loops are available for those who need them, ensuring hearing-impaired travelers get the assistance they need.

Accessibility is important to any travel plans, and Woodhouse station tries to cater for it. Platform 1, which serves Sheffield-bound trains, is accessible to wheelchair users, though unfortunately, access to Platform 2 still requires using a footbridge with steps. It might not be the pinnacle of accessibility, but at least a step-free access route is partially available. For any help, passengers can rely on a helpline service or utilize the customer help points distributed across the station.

Amenities and Travel Connections

Woodhouse doesn't provide extensive dining or shopping options; you won't find any refreshment facilities, ATMs, or shops gracing its platforms. This might make it less ideal for those who wish to grab a quick sandwich or a cup of coffee before boarding. However, there is ample seating available while you wait for your train.

Those planning onward travel have reasonable options at Woodhouse. Nearby bus stops and designated bays for rail replacement services offer seamless connections. For a more personalized journey, visitors can arrange rides via the Cab4You service, making it simple to bridge the gap between the station and your destination. Although bicycle hire isn't available, there is space to park your own bike should you choose to travel with it.
